This AI Blog Generator is an advanced n8n-powered automation workflow that leverages Google Gemini and Google Sheets to generate SEO-friendly blog articles for Shopify products. It automates the entire process β from fetching product data to creating structured HTML content β with zero manual effort.
π‘ Key Advantages
Our AI Blog Generator offers five core advantages that make it the perfect solution for automated content creation:
- π Shopify Product Sync β Automatically pulls product data (titles, descriptions, images, etc.) via Shopify API.
- βοΈ SEO Blog Generation β Gemini generates blog titles, meta descriptions, and complete articles using product information.
- ποΈ Structured Content Output β Creates well-formatted HTML with headers and bullet points for seamless Shopify blog integration.
- π Google Sheets Integration β Tracks blog creation and prevents duplicate publishing using a centralized Google Sheet.
- π€ Shopify Blog API Integration β Publishes the generated blog to Shopify with a single API call.
βοΈ How It Works
The workflow follows a systematic 8-step process that ensures quality and efficiency:
Step-by-Step Process
- Manual Trigger β Start the workflow via a test trigger or scheduler.
- Fetch Products from Shopify β Retrieves all product details, including images and descriptions.
- Fix Input Format β Organizes and updates the input table using Code and Google Sheet nodes.
- Filter Duplicates β Ensures no previously used rows are processed again.
- Limit Control β Processes one row at a time and loops until all blogs are posted.
- Gemini AI Generation β Creates SEO-friendly blog content in HTML format from product data.
- HTML Structure Fix β Adjusts content for JSON compatibility by cleaning unsupported HTML tags.
- Article API Posting β Sends finalized blog content to Shopify for publishing or drafting.
π οΈ Setup Steps
Required Node Configuration
To implement this workflow, you'll need to configure the following n8n nodes:
- Trigger Node: Start the workflow instantly.
- Shopify Node: Fetch product details.
- Google Sheet Node: Store input/output data and track blog creation status.
- Code Node: Format data as required.
- Filter Node: Remove used rows to avoid duplication.
- Limit Node: Process one blog at a time.
- Agent Node: Sends prompt to Gemini and returns parsed SEO-ready content.
- HTTP Node: Posts content to Shopify via the API.
π Credentials Required
Authentication Setup
Before running the workflow, ensure you have the following credentials configured:
- Shopify Access Token β For fetching products and posting blogs
- Gemini API Key β For AI-powered blog generation
- Google Sheets OAuth β For logging and tracking workflow data
π€ Ideal For
Target Users
This automation workflow is specifically designed for:
- Ecommerce teams automating blogs for hundreds of products
- Shopify store owners boosting organic traffic effortlessly
- Marketing teams building scalable, AI-driven content workflows
π¬ Bonus Tip
Extensibility Features
The workflow is fully modular and highly customizable. You can easily extend it for:
- Internal linking between related products
- Multi-language translation for global markets
- Social media sharing automation
- Email marketing integration
All extensions can be implemented within the same n8n flow, making it a comprehensive content automation solution.